DevExpress XtraTreeList将焦点行外观设置为仅显示背景颜色变化

时间:2010-04-28 07:27:04

标签: devexpress xtratreelist

有没有办法设置一个选定/聚焦的行外观,以便它使行只有边界(没有背景颜色变化,边框颜色为红色)?

2 个答案:

答案 0 :(得分:3)

单击控件右上角的智能标记按钮,然后选择“运行设计器”。

Smart Tag

然后在左侧的外观选项卡下,您可以专门设置控件中大多数组件的颜色

Appearances

答案 1 :(得分:2)

对我来说,FocusedRow / SelectedRow不起作用,但可以通过FocusedCell获得所需的结果 (在treelist designer - > Appearance选项卡中,然后从Appearances列表中选择FocusedCell)

修改

默认情况下,FocusedRow和FocusedCell外观均已启用,因此如果您有一个具有一个可见列的树形图,则不会(因为我没有)看到FocusedRow设置的效果。在这种情况下,你必须禁用FocusedCell外观(或只是在FocusedCell配置必要的外观,而不是FocusedRow)

XtraTreelist.OptionsSelection.EnableAppearanceFocusedCell = false;

P.S。我正在使用DevExpress 13.2.5版本